Coke Chicken

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:35 mins
Total Time:45 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 4 pieces Chicken thighs or drumsticks (skin-on, bone-in)
  • 1 cup Coca-Cola (regular, not diet)
  • 1 tablespoon Soy sauce
  • 2 cloves Garlic (minced)
  • 1 tablespoon Vegetable oil
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 2 stalks Green onions (sliced, optional for garnish)
  • 1 teaspoon Sesame seeds (optional for garnish)

Directions

Step 1

Prepare the chicken by patting it dry with paper towels. Season both sides with salt and black pepper.

Step 2

Heat the vegetable oil in a large skillet or sauté pan over medium-high heat.

Step 3

Once the oil is hot, add the chicken pieces, skin side down. Sear for about 4–5 minutes until the skin is golden and crispy. Flip the chicken and sear the other side for another 4–5 minutes.

Step 4

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side on a plate.

Step 5

In the same skillet, reduce the heat to medium and add the minced garlic. Sauté for about 30 seconds, or until fragrant, taking care not to burn it.

Step 6

Pour the Coca-Cola and soy sauce into the skillet, stirring to combine. Allow the mixture to come to a simmer.

Step 7

Return the chicken to the skillet, arranging the pieces in a single layer. Reduce the heat to medium-low and cover the skillet with a lid.

Step 8

Cook the chicken for about 25 minutes, flipping the pieces halfway through to ensure even cooking.

Step 9

Remove the lid and increase the heat to medium-high. Let the sauce simmer and reduce until it thickens into a glaze, about 5–7 minutes. Frequently spoon the sauce over the chicken as it reduces.

Step 10

Once the sauce has thickened and coats the chicken nicely, remove the skillet from the heat.

Step 11

Transfer the chicken to a serving platter. Garnish with sliced green onions and sesame seeds if desired. Serve immediately with rice or vegetables.
